## Local Setup

Coinbridge converts ledger amounts at query time. Known issue: half-cent rounding drift in the EUR-to-KRW path. Do not patch locally; the fix lands in the `rounding-v2` branch. Run migrations with `make seed` before testing conversions, or totals will mismatch by a cent. Point your local instance at the shared staging database using the connection string below.

warehouse DSN: mssql://rusdor_svc:0FSWCn9@db-951a.paliqforge.local:5432/ulawyn

Subject: Key rotation — Bannerly consent service

Team, we're rotating credentials for the Bannerly service ahead of the consent banner rollout to the remaining regions next week. The old key stops working Friday at 18:00. Update the deploy config and the nightly compliance job; nothing else consumes this credential. Rollout flags are unchanged — only authentication is affected. If a maintainer after us needs to rotate again, the procedure is in the runbook under "consent services." The new key for the internal Bannerly API follows.

app token of bahaf-tajeg = zpat23_SjjsllwiLmXbtS65veZaV47

# Runbook: Hunting leaked file descriptors in Quillgate

When the `fd_open` gauge climbs steadily between deploys, suspect a leak rather than load. First confirm on a single pod: exec in and count entries under `/proc/1/fd`, noting how many are sockets in CLOSE_WAIT versus regular files. Capture two snapshots ten minutes apart before restarting anything — we need the delta for the postmortem. Reproduce locally with the Marbury load harness, which requires the service running with the following configuration values.

settings of yagep-bajog:
[istdor]
port = 4000
region = south-2
host = istdor.qorvelcorp.internal
timeout_ms = 5000
retries = 5

## Data Stores — Digest Scheduling

The Mossgate digest scheduler reads pending batches from the `digest_queue` table every fifteen minutes. Rows are claimed with an advisory lock to prevent double-sends; if a worker dies mid-claim, the lock expires after ten minutes and the batch is retried. Maintainers should check `claimed_at` timestamps before manually requeueing anything. The scheduler and the admin tooling both reach the queue database via the connection string below.

replica DSN, kajep-yahag: mssql://praok_svc:iF@db-8d68.plorvaio.local:5432/eliion